The Role

Platform engineering is looking for the next front-end engineer to join our web platform team. You will partner with the members of your squad to deliver outstanding customer experiences and set the direction for front end engineering excellence within Fidelity's web platform. As a member of the team, you will architect, build, test, and design components, capabilities, tools, and products to enable digital squads working within typescript workspaces. You will provide guidance and technical expertise within your existing squad and across squads within the wider Fidelity technical organization.

The Team

The workspace web platform team focuses on creating a unified developer experience across Fidelity and will be involved in the hands-on creation of standardized tools for testing frameworks, developer environments, bundler and build system implementations, CI jobs, client libraries for observability and experimentation, editor integrations, and REST + GraphQL implementations. Our goal is to create an environment that empowers productive development without compromising quality. The team will directly impact the productivity and experience of front-end developers across multiple product areas.

The Expertise and Skills You Bring

  • 4+ years hands on experience as front-end software engineer using modern JavaScript frameworks, especially Angular.
  • 1+ years of using Nx workspace and strong familiarity with monorepos
  • Experience preparing design artifacts, and implementing solutions for agile teams.
  • Robust critical thinking skills coupled with a desire for growth, to learn and to engage with peers in technical and design discussions
  • A long-term mentality to help produce scalable, maintainable solutions
  • Learn quickly, adapt and thrive to meet the needs of a fast-paced and evolving environment
  • Demonstrated ability to coach, mentor, and develop technology associates
  • Excellent leadership, communication, collaboration, and influencing skills


Your background:
  • Angular, Typescript, HTML, CSS, SCSS, JavaScript
  • GraphQL
  • REST API
  • NX Workspace or other monorepo
  • Jest, Playwright, Cypress
  • Web Components, Component Architecture
  • Storybook or other component discovery
  • GIT, Jenkins(Or similar Build Tooling, e.g. Circle CI, GitHub), Node.js
  • Managing Shared Libraries, Working with design systems
Helpful but not required:
  • WCAG 2.1+ and AA/AAA Standards
  • AWS
